Springfield Memorial Gardens Funeral Home & Cremation Center is a funeral home in Springfield, TN that accepts veteran families and provides military funeral honors coordination through the Department of Defense honors program.
Published pricing at Springfield Memorial Gardens Funeral Home & Cremation Center: direct cremation from $1,995. Veterans who served on active duty for at least 24 months may qualify for VA burial allowance to offset funeral costs — this home accepts assignment of those benefits where eligible.
The nearest VA national cemetery is Nashville National Cemetery in TN, approximately 18 miles from Springfield Memorial Gardens Funeral Home & Cremation Center. Springfield Memorial Gardens Funeral Home & Cremation Center can coordinate transport, scheduling with the cemetery's interment office, and the timing of military honors with the receiving committal shelter.

The veteran's spouse may qualify for VA Dependency & Indemnity Compensation.
DIC is a tax-free monthly benefit for surviving spouses, dependent children, and (in some cases) parents of veterans whose death is service-connected. Military funeral honors are guaranteed at no cost for any veteran discharged under conditions other than dishonorable. The funeral home arranges the honors detail by contacting the deceased's last unit or the nearest active-duty installation of the appropriate branch and submitting the DD-214 to verify eligibility.
For requests less than 72 hours from service time, families can call the Department of Defense's expedited honors line at 1-877-MIL-HONR (1-877-645-4667). See the full honors protocol.
